We pop in to check out the river at the entrance to the Makgadikgadi Game Reserve near the main road. The river is in flood. Trees are under water and the park inaccessible from this side. We recall one of our first trips, perhaps 20 years ago when we crossed the Boteti as a swollen river. Our trailer actually floated as we crossed. We鈥檙e back on the long tar road north to Maun, wondering what the water level is going to be like there. At 4pm on Day 2, we enter Maun, on the eastern fringe of the Delta. What used to be an almost derelict outpost, a frontier town leading into the Okavango, the tar road that has brought us here has also brought bustle to Maun. 鈥淚 remember when we used to get stuck in Maun.鈥?Hennie remarks and he鈥檚 referring to sand, not traffic. Now Maun has parking fees.
HE man from Land Rover looked and sounded reassuringly confident. Set the Terrain Response for grass/gravel/snow, switch on the Hill Descent Control, ease the car over the top, take your feet off the pedals and the car will do the rest,' he said. At the top of this particular hill on Anglesey, the bonnet of the new Range Rover Evoque was pointing skywards. Slightly apprehensive, we inched the nose over the top. The drop seemed terrifying but the brakes kicked in with the HDC and we crawled down at about three miles an hour. Despite its compact size the Evoque has been put through the same Evoque punishing test and development regime as its larger Freelander and Range Rover cousins. The Evoque, being built exclusively on Merseyside at the Halewood plant, goes on sale in September. This new mini-sport utility vehicle, the smallest ever Range Rover, is targeted at BMW's X1 and Audi's Q3.

Toyota will price the RX 400h/Harrier Hybrid at a substantial premium over the non-hybrid RX 300/ RX 330/ Harrier. The list price in Japan ranges from 4.095 million Yen to 4.62 million Yen. The assistance of the electric motor increases the vehicle's performance; the 400h/ Harrier Hybrid can reach 60 mph (97 km/h) in less than 8 s, quicker than the petrol-only RX. Despite the increased performance, the RX 400h/ Harrier Hybrid consumes roughly the same amount of petrol as a compact four-cylinder saloon and it qualifies as a Super Ultra Low Emission Vehicle (SULEV) in America. The 2007 Lexus RX 350 features a 24-valve V6 engine with 270 horsepower at 6,200 RPM and 251 pound-feet of torque at 4,700 RPM. To ensure the most comfortable driving experience, the RX 350 comes standard with a five-speed automatic Electronically Controlled Transmission (ECT), which provides improved acceleration at lower speeds. And on the highway, a smoother, quieter ride. The RX comes with front-wheel drive (FWD) or available all-wheel drive (AWD) featuring a viscous limited-slip center differential.
